are these two the same paper? any reason for difference in
titles?

source1: (citeseer)

@misc{ pike90plan,
  author = "R. Pike and D. Presotto and K. Thompson and H. Trickey",
  title = "Plan 9 from Bell Labs",
  text = "R. Pike, D. Presotto, K. Thompson & H. Trickey (1990) Plan 9 from Bell
    Labs, Proc. of the Summer 1990 UKUUG Conf., London, July 1990, pp. 1-9.",
  year = "1990",
  url = "citeseer.comp.nus.edu.sg/article/pike90plan.html" }

source 2: (http://www.math.utah.edu/pub/tex/bib/plan9.html)

@InProceedings{Pike:1990:PBLb,
  author =       "R. Pike and D. Presotto and K. Thompson and H.
                 Trickey",
  booktitle =    "UKUUG. UNIX - The Legend Evolves. Proceedings of the
                 Summer 1990 UKUUG Conference",
  title =        "{Plan 9} from {Bell Labs}",
  publisher =    pub-UKUUG,
  address =      pub-UKUUG:adr,
  pages =        "1--9 (of xi + 260)",
  year =         "1990",
  ISBN =         "0-9513181-7-9",
  LCCN =         "????",
  bibdate =      "Sat Mar 22 15:10:17 MST 1997",
  note =         "See also \cite{Jacob:1996:AMD}.",
  acknowledgement = ack-nhfb,
  classcodes =   "B6210L (Computer communications); C6150J (Operating
                 systems); C5630 (Networking equipment); C5620 (Computer
                 networks and techniques)",
  conflocation = "London, UK; 9-13 July 1990",
  corpsource =   "AT&T Bell Lab., Murray Hill, NJ, USA",
  keywords =     "building blocks; CPU servers; distributed computing
                 environment; distributed processing; distributed
                 systems; file; file servers; file-oriented protocol;
                 interconnections; local name space; multiprocessing;
                 operations; Plan 9; programs; protocols; security;
                 servers; specialised components; terminals",
  treatment =    "P Practical",
}

These were two sources for the same (1990) paper; sorry if that wasn't
clear.  Compare the 1990 paper at
<http://www.ecf.utoronto.ca/plan9/plan9doc/2.ps> with the 1995 paper
at <http://plan9.bell-labs.com/sys/doc/9.ps>; there's some overlap in
subject but these are different texts.
